Compiz 在早期版本的 Ubuntu 中占用了大约 60-65 MB 的 RAM。在 Ubuntu 14.04 中,大约需要 205-201 MB。在早期版本中,Nautilus 占用了 35 MB 的 RAM,现在最少占用了 65 MB。自 13.10 以来,我的 RAM 总使用量约为 500-600 MB。自 14.04 安装以来,它的使用量已增加到 1.2 GB
小智 4
我相信我刚刚遇到了同样的问题,现在已经为自己解决了。我认为这个问题与交换有关。
\n\n我最近还在整个磁盘上重新安装了 14.04,之前曾成功使用过 13.10。我也注意到我的内存大部分使用量都在 1.2GB 左右,正如该人的问题中所述。我强烈怀疑这个人可能使用了整个磁盘加密,这是 Ubuntu 安装的一部分,这可能导致了这个问题。
\n\n我的症状是,有时 Ubuntu 会变得几乎完全无响应,即使是典型的少量打开程序和活动,而这些程序和活动在我的旧 Ubuntu 安装上的表现还可以接受。起初我以为是 Firefox 或 Software Center 有关。
\n\nDell Optiplex 780(小型/sff)
\n\n奔腾(R) 双核 CPU E5300 @ 2.60GHz \xc3\x97 2
\n\n内存 2GB(计划很快升级到 8 或更多)
\n\n视频 Intel\xc2\xae Q45/Q43
\n\n我注意到在系统监视器程序中,在资源选项卡中它显示交换为“不可用”(或类似的内容)。这是 14.04 的全新安装。我使用了整个磁盘加密,并认为它可能与此有关。我在磁盘程序中检查了交换分区是否存在,发现交换分区至少确实存在并且看起来合适。它被称为:/dev/mapper/ubuntu--vg-swap_1这是正确的。
我还确认了它在终端中的存在:
\n\nsudo fdisk -a\nRun Code Online (Sandbox Code Playgroud)\n\n我做了一些谷歌搜索,并决定它可能没有被激活为交换,即使空间已创建,所以我停用了交换:
\n\nsudo swapoff -a\nRun Code Online (Sandbox Code Playgroud)\n\n然后我告诉它将该空间识别为交换空间:
\n\nsudo mkswap /dev/mapper/ubuntu--vg-swap_1\nRun Code Online (Sandbox Code Playgroud)\n\n然后我打开交换:
\n\nsudo swapon -a\nRun Code Online (Sandbox Code Playgroud)\n\n然后我收到了一条关于 cryptsetup swap blah blah blah 的消息,这是适当的,但我没有收到有关 的消息/dev/mapper/ubuntu--vg-swap_1,尽管在执行这些步骤之前收到了一条消息。
我重新打开系统监视器,发现它现在确实识别并使用了我的交换空间。为了更好的措施,我重新启动了计算机,它再次快速正常运行,就像安装 14.04 之前一样。
\n\n我想如果我没有这么低的 RAM,我可能不会注意到很多问题,这使得激活交换空间非常重要。
\n| 归档时间: |
|
| 查看次数: |
16715 次 |
| 最近记录: |